Formula 1 | Dutch GP, Lammers attacks Assen: "I haven't been an option for some time now"

Speaking to the newspaper Algemeen Dagblad, Jan Lammers heavily criticized the management of the negotiations for a possible Dutch Grand Prix, underlining how the situation inherent to the Assen track is strongly penalizing the plan provided by Zandvoort to Liberty Media.

According to what was reported by the new sporting director of the Dutch facility, in fact, Assen would not be a real alternative for the organization of the Grand Prix, given that the only track capable of hosting an event of this type would be Zandvoort.

Lammers, precisely in this sense, believes that this situation is only creating confusion, an aspect that could push Liberty Media to look for other solutions in Asia or America.

Here are the words of Jan Lammers: “There are a lot of falsehoods surrounding this situation. The confusion doesn't help the Dutch Grand Prix, but unfortunately this is the arena in which we have to compete.

“The promoters try to make us believe differently that Assen is a real alternative, but in reality this is not the case, given that they have no longer been an option for some time now”, he added. “The truth is that Zandvoort is the only solution to have a Dutch Grand Prix. The alternative for Liberty is to go to Asia or America."
